发明名称 LAMINATED MAGNETIC THIN FILM AND MAGNETIC COMPONENT
摘要 <P>PROBLEM TO BE SOLVED: To provide a laminated magnetic thin film and a magnetic component capable of suppressing increase in ferromagnetic resonance line width and extending an operation frequency, using a granular magnetic material with a high ferromagnetic resonance frequency. <P>SOLUTION: A laminated magnetic thin film 10 has a structure of alternately laminating a granular magnetic layer 12 with magnetic particles 16 dispersed in an insulator medium 14 and an insulation layer 18, and Pd for promoting crystal orientation is added in the magnetic particles 16. The added amount of Pd is preferably 20% or more to the Co-Fe magnetic particles 16 in the laminated magnetic thin film 10 having the granular magnetic layer 12 of CoFePdSiO and the insulating layer 18 of SiO<SB POS="POST">2</SB>. The lamination structure of the granular magnetic layer 12 and the insulating layer 18 suppresses increase in a ferromagnetic resonance line width resulting from dispersion in a direction of a magnetization easy axis by suppressing particle size distribution of the magnetic particle 16 to constantly keeps intervals of the magnetic particles 16 in a thickness direction of the film and promoting crystal orientation of the magnetic particles 16 by addition of the Pd. <P>COPYRIGHT: (C)2013,JPO&INPIT
